      Hi David! I'd say it's rather for a general idea and orientation, but here you are, a table with different exams compared from the NATO website: www.nato.int/structur/recruit/info-doc/Language%20test%20equivalence%20table_FINAL2011.pdf
      However, I do not agree with it. Imo Level 2 is definitely more than A2 level (I'd say it's B1-B1+) and Level 3 is closer to C1 rather than B2.

    I don't really know how you can define the specific features of the STANAG 6001 exam as there's no such official exam. You don't pass SLP 3 or 4, you must demonstrate evidence of your proficiency regarding the criteria and the descriptors of the STANAG during an assessment. NATO countries are free to design their own tests to assess their staff, provided they respect STANAG 6001 criteria. Therefore, there's no tricks or tips to pass any level. This is pure BS.
